Experience a professional epi-fluorescence and brightfield microscope system designed for advanced biology research, cytology, and environmental work. The OMAX package combines a trinocular head, four fluorescence objectives, a powerful 100W HBO lamp, and a high resolution 18MP USB 3.0 camera. Whether you are preparing slides for fluorescence imaging or reviewing standard brightfield samples, this instrument offers flexible operation without requiring disassembly.

Key imaging capability is supported by a wide magnification range from 40x to 2500x, allowing you to switch from overview to detail. The 0.5X reduction lens expands the field of view on your computer screen, helping you capture larger regions of interest at desktop scale. The built in condenser and adjustable iris provide precise illumination control for consistent results across slides.

Beyond optics, the system includes a robust set of digital tools. The 18MP camera streams live video, captures high resolution stills, and works with Windows, Mac OS X, and Linux. The software offers Stitching for panoramic assembly, Extended Depth of Focus for depth from samples, video recording, and measurement functions for length, angle, and area. You can run live preview and capture at different resolutions simultaneously, improving your workflow flexibility.

Using fluorescence is straightforward thanks to a three position filter assembly with blue and green excitation filters and corresponding barrier filters. The system ships with four high quality fluorescence objectives and a double layer mechanical stage that supports two slides with stable movement. In brightfield mode, the built in halogen illumination and NA1.25 condenser deliver bright, crisp views.

Practical use cases include observing stained specimens, tracking cell morphology, or examining microstructures in environmental samples.
